
Sarah interviews Shanna Hatfield about her novel The Bridge, exploring its themes and character dynamics during a holiday crisis.
Sarah chats with Shanna Hatfield about the inspiration behind this suspenseful and uplifting story, the characters whose lives collide during one unforgettable moment, and the powerful themes of hope, courage, and second chances that shape the novel. Set on the iconic St. Johns Bridge in Portland, The Bridge follows five strangers whose lives intersect during a tense holiday crisis. Sergeant Archer Raines is determined to finally spend Christmas with his wife, but duty calls when a desperate man threatens to jump from the bridge. Meanwhile, Rosalee, a meticulous accountant and expectant mother, finds her carefully organized world thrown into chaos when she goes into labor during a traffic standstill. Exhausted nurse Nova, tow truck operator Carter, and recent graduate Ian are also pulled into the unfolding drama, each facing unexpected choices that could change their lives forever. During the interview, Shanna shares how she built a story around a single pivotal moment and created a cast of characters whose journeys highlight compassion, resilience, and human connection.
